my bust the KXE is FIM enduro comp model built up from the KXF250 by the Kaw importer KL Motors

It is common practice in EU (Italia) for these specials just like all the HM Honda and Suz Valenti models.

All the WEC bikes from Japan are built this way Honda HM, Kaw KL Motors, Suz Valenti

(except to a degree Yam which has a base WR model but normally they start with a YZ and go from there)

I think the KLX250 is more the equiv to the Yam DS 250 machine
